[0017] Embodiment of the present invention: earlier at the wellhead, several acoustic pulse signals (such as image 3 As shown, the wellhead uses an electric horn to fire three acoustic pulse signals with a pulse width of 10ms), and records the time interval between them (for example image 3 As shown, the time interval T2 between the first and the second sound pulse signal is 50ms, and the time interval T3 between the first and the third sound pulse signal is 200ms.
